Specification

The Benzenesulfonamide,4-amino-N-(4-methyl-2-pyrimidinyl)-, with the CAS registry number 127-79-7, is also known as 2-(4-Aminobenzenesulfonamido)-4-methylpyrimidine. It belongs to the product categories of Aromatics; Heterocycles; Intermediates & Fine Chemicals; Pharmaceuticals; Sulfur & Selenium Compounds. Its EINECS number is 204-866-2. This chemical's molecular formula is C11H12N4O2S and molecular weight is 264.30. What's more, its systematic name is 4-amino-N-(4-methylpyrimidin-2-yl)benzenesulfonamide. Its classification codes are: (1)Anti-infective agents; (2)Antibacterial; (3)Drug / Therapeutic Agent; (4)Reproductive Effect. It is a sulfanilamide that is used as an antibacterial agent. 

Physical properties of Benzenesulfonamide,4-amino-N-(4-methyl-2-pyrimidinyl)- are: (1)ACD/LogP: 0.34; (2)# of Rule of 5 Violations: 0; (3)ACD/LogD (pH 5.5): 0.34; (4)ACD/LogD (pH 7.4): -0.01; (5)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 1.06; (6)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 1; (7)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 36.04; (8)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 16.4; (9)#H bond acceptors: 6; (10)#H bond donors: 3; (11)#Freely Rotating Bonds: 2; (12)Polar Surface Area: 74.78 Å2; (13)Index of Refraction: 1.66; (14)Molar Refractivity: 67.76 cm3; (15)Molar Volume: 183.5 cm3; (16)Polarizability: 26.86×10-24cm3; (17)Surface Tension: 76.4 dyne/cm; (18)Density: 1.439 g/cm3; (19)Flash Point: 267.8 °C; (20)Enthalpy of Vaporization: 79.18 kJ/mol; (21)Boiling Point: 519.1 °C at 760 mmHg; (22)Vapour Pressure: 7.03E-11 mmHg at 25°C.

Uses of Benzenesulfonamide,4-amino-N-(4-methyl-2-pyrimidinyl)-: it can be used to produce N-(4-methyl-pyrimidin-2-yl)-4-(3-oxo-1-thia-4-aza-spiro[4.4]non-4-yl)-benzenesulfonamide by heating. It will need solvent pyridine with the reaction time of 2 hours. The yield is about 78%.

When you are using this chemical, please be cautious about it as the following:
It is ir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in. In case of contact with eyes, you should r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ice. When using it, you need wear suitable protective clothing and gloves.

The toxicity data is as follows:  

Organism Test Type Route Reported Dose (Normalized Dose) Effect Source
mouse LD50 intraperitoneal 1400mg/kg (1400mg/kg)   Arzneimittel-Forschung. Drug Research. Vol. 5, Pg. 213, 1955.
mouse LD50 oral 25gm/kg (25000mg/kg)   Archives Internationales de Pharmacodynamie et de Therapie. Vol. 94, Pg. 338, 1953.
mouse LD50 subcutaneous 1190mg/kg (1190mg/kg)   Acta Biologica et Medica Germanica. Vol. 27, Pg. 141, 1971.
rat LD50 intravenous 1100mg/kg (1100mg/kg)   Naunyn-Schmiedeberg's Archiv fuer Experimentelle Pathologie und Pharmakologie. Vol. 211, Pg. 367, 1950.
rat LD50 subcutaneous 1890mg/kg (1890mg/kg)   Acta Biologica et Medica Germanica. Vol. 27, Pg. 141, 1971.
